article thumbnail

Scientists accidentally create the world's lightest paint by mimicking Mother Nature

TechSpot

Take a peacock feather, for example. Submicroscopic ridges and contours in a peacock feather diffract light to create the iridescent blues and greens we see. This natural coloring is called structural color.

article thumbnail

Pwn2Own 2023 day one, all major operating systems and Tesla Model 3 hacked

TechSpot

Trend Micro's Zero Day Initiative (ZDI) announced Pwn2Own 2023's first-round winners. Five participants earned $375,000 in prize money from an over $1 million pool by hacking widely popular operating systems, software programs, and a Tesla Model 3 car. The hackers found 12 zero-day vulnerabilities in all.

article thumbnail

Accenture to lay off 19,000 to cut costs amid economic uncertainty

CIO Business Intelligence

IT services and consultancy firm Accenture said it would lay off 19,000 staffers, or 2.5% of its workforce, over the next 18 months to reduce costs amid uncertain macroeconomic conditions. “While we continue to hire, especially to support our strategic growth priorities, during the second quarter of fiscal 2023, we initiated actions to streamline our operations and transform our non-billable corporate functions to reduce costs,” the company said in an Securities & Exchange Commission (SEC)
